Htaccess是一个用于Apache服务器的配置文件,它可以用来对网站进行各种设置和重定向。当需要将特定的URL重定向到主页时,可以通过Htaccess文件来实现。
具体的步骤如下:
- 创建或编辑网站根目录下的.htaccess文件(注意文件名以点开头)。
- 在.htaccess文件中添加以下代码:
RewriteEngine On
RewriteRule ^specific-url$ / [R=301,L]
上述代码中,specific-url
是需要重定向的特定URL,/
表示重定向到网站的主页。R=301
表示使用301永久重定向,L
表示停止后续规则的处理。
- 保存并上传.htaccess文件到网站的根目录。
这样,当用户访问特定URL时,服务器会自动将其重定向到主页。
Htaccess的优势在于它可以通过简单的配置实现URL重定向等功能,而无需修改网站的源代码。它还可以用于实现其他功能,如URL重写、访问控制、缓存控制等。
适用场景:
- 重定向特定URL:当需要将某些特定的URL重定向到主页或其他页面时,可以使用Htaccess进行配置。
- URL重写:通过Htaccess可以将复杂的URL转化为简洁易读的形式,提高用户体验和SEO效果。
- 访问控制:可以使用Htaccess来限制或允许特定IP地址或用户访问网站的某些部分。
- 缓存控制:通过Htaccess可以设置网页的缓存策略,提高网站的加载速度和性能。
腾讯云相关产品和产品介绍链接地址:
- 腾讯云服务器(CVM):提供稳定可靠的云服务器实例,支持灵活的配置和管理。产品介绍链接
- 腾讯云CDN:提供全球加速和分发服务,加速网站内容传输,提高用户访问速度。产品介绍链接
- 腾讯云域名注册:提供域名注册和管理服务,方便用户注册和管理自己的域名。产品介绍链接
- 腾讯云SSL证书:提供数字证书服务,保护网站数据传输的安全性。产品介绍链接
- 腾讯云云数据库MySQL版:提供高性能、可扩展的云数据库服务,支持MySQL数据库。产品介绍链接
- 腾讯云对象存储(COS):提供安全可靠的云存储服务,用于存储和管理各种类型的数据。产品介绍链接